Katadyn Hiker Pro Water Microfilter

The Katadyn Hiker Pro Water Microfilter possesses all the lightweight filter qualities you love in the Hiker, but adds a quick release feed hose and Quick Fill Hydration Pack Adaptors. Thoroughly abused and given a rave review by Backpacker Magazine, the Hiker Pro stands up to the test of backcountry abuse. Hard to clog and easily field serviceable, this durable filter eliminates Giardia, Cryptosporidium and all bacteria and microorganisms. This Katadyn water filter also comes with a field replacement kit for extended trips. When a broken filter would mean the end of your trip, count on the Hiker Pro.

What about viruses? I'm going to South East Asia and don't want...

What about viruses? I'm going to South East Asia and don't want to worry about hepatitis etc - is there a better solution? I'm on a budget as well.

Steripen does not have a unblemished record. Please note their reviews on this site. Where there can be problems with Virus in the water: Asia, Africa, S. America I recommend microfiltering, then Katadyn Micropur tablets. The Katadyn Hiker Pro removes all Protozoa & Bacteria: then add 1 Katadyn Micropur tablet per liter, and wait 15 minutes for it to kill all virus. Works in any kind of water-no batteries, no fragile electronics, no problem. Ray

Getting down and dirty with Katadyn filters:

Glassfiber-
Superfine glassfiber, within two supporting layers, forms a depth filter. Nominal pore size of 0.3 micron mechanically filters all bacteria and protozoa. The flexible glassfiber is pleated resulting in an extremely large surface area and a very high capacity to absorb dirt.

Activated Carbon-
Activated carbon is used for its ability to reduce harmful organic and inorganic substances in the water. It removes unpleasant tastes, odours, chlorine, pesticides (lindane, DDT) and trihalomethanes (THMs). These substances adhere to the large surface area of the activated carbon. Activated carbon granulate cannot be regenerated.

Great Filter

By:
October 29, 2006

The Hiker is a great filter that will give you years of reliability and efficiency. The system is light and very compact. I don't like the pump system as much as the MSR Miniworks but overall it has better features than the MSR. You won't break the filter if you drop it like the ceramic MSR one's and the quick disconnects are nice which allow you too backfill your bladder. The hiker doesn't clog very easily either.(I used the MSR in Yellowstones water's and I had to scrub it every 1 or 2 fills) You can't go wrong with the Hiker Pro because of its reliability, efficiency, weight, and compactness when stored.

Tech Specs:

Filter Construction: Glass-fiber w/ activated carbon core
Adapter Base: No
Gravity Flow: No
Field Maintainable: Yes
Output: 1 liter per minute (48 strokes)
Weight: 11oz
Warranty: 1 year
